Just a quick question i'm not 100% sure on;

 

I'm planning to purchase a Hannspree HG324QJB 144hz 1440p monitor, and want to use my current 1080p 60hz monitor as a second monitor along with it.

Just want to make sure, is it possible to run a 144hz 1440p monitor and a 60hz 1080p monitor at the same time?

I'm not planning to use the 1080p for gaming or anything like that, it'll just be off to the side for web browsing and such.

 

Another part to the question - the 1440p monitor also has freesync and is supposedly 'g-sync compatible' from what I've read, will that also run while the other monitor does not support it?

 

I'm using an RTX 2060, btw.
